【问题标题】:How is the Azure DevOps Service version determined?Azure DevOps 服务版本是如何确定的?
【发布时间】:2021-02-26 07:38:22
【问题描述】:

Azure DevOps Service 有一个版本号,我们可以通过浏览到 https://dev.azure.com/my_organization/_home/about 看到它(见下文)。
我的问题是这个版本是如何确定的?
我猜(在本例中)164 是 sprint 编号,而 .1 是 sprint 中的构建。
但是不清楚“Dev18”代表什么?它是如何确定的,何时改变?

我知道这个问题对 SaaS 没有多大意义,但在我们的案例(受监管的环境)中它确实如此。

【问题讨论】:

    标签: azure-devops


    【解决方案1】:

    据我所知,Dev18 没有多大意义。在大多数情况下,只有M164 很重要,因为有时我们可能需要它来确定您是否在一个有最新更新的地区。

    我刚刚从在这个主题上更有经验的工程师那里得到了一些帮助,我们可以确认这种关系:

    Dev18<=>TFS 2020
    Dev17<=>TFS 2019
    Dev16<=>TFS 2018
    Dev15<=>TFS 2017
    Dev14<=>TFS 2015
    

    所以 DavaShaw 的猜测是正确的。它是 TFS 的主要版本,因此不会经常更改。我认为只有在发布新的 TFS 版本时才会改变。希望对您有所帮助。

    【讨论】:

    • 感谢您的回复,并且只有 sprint 编号才有意义……但是,“Dev18”版本是否会更改?如果有,频率如何?
    • 不频繁,等新的tfs版本发布,就会变。
    • 此链接列出了名称及其版本(假设 Dev18.M164.1 表示 18.164.X):docs.microsoft.com/en-us/rest/api/azure/…(但是,我不太确定 18.164 是否低于 18.170 中提到的列表。)
    【解决方案2】:

    我猜 Dev18 是 Azure DevOps Server 的主要版本。

    虽然,我不能确定,但​​一些推论让我相信它是......

    VS 和 TFS 版本曾经是同步的:

    • TFS 和 VS 2015 - 为 14.X
    • TFS 和 VS 2017 - 为 15.X

    但是节奏中断了:

    • VS 2019 现在是 16.X
    • Azure DevOps Server 2018 - 也是 16.X
    • Azure DevOps Server 2019 - 将是 17.X

    Azure DevOps 始终领先于 Azure DevOps Server 安装,因此假设 Azure DevOps Server 的下一个版本将是 18.X - 可能称为 Server 2020 似乎是合理的。

    说了这么多……

    对于 Azure DevOps,您应该只关注您所处的 Sprint 里程碑 .

    【讨论】:

    • 这也是我的猜测 - 谢谢@DaveShaw!但是,我正在寻找官方(或半官方)确认...
    猜你喜欢
    • 2020-06-11
    • 1970-01-01
    • 2019-10-15
    • 2022-06-14
    • 1970-01-01
    • 2020-09-03
    • 1970-01-01
    • 2021-10-15
    • 2020-07-27
    相关资源
    最近更新 更多